Despite the Okanagan Valley having been settled from the mid-1800s onwards, there are surprisingly few yesteryear photos of the area to be had on the web, so it was with no small amount of excitement that I just about leapt off the sofa when I spied the delightful image below one day on Flickr.





Aside from a date of 1949 (which appears on the sash of the woman on the far left of the picture), the Flickr poster didn't provide any further information about this shot, but the photo itself speaks volumes and clearly depicts a group of beauty pageant winners from various B.C. towns, surrounding an unidentified man as he tries his hand at ironing. I have no idea who this fellow was, but I'd venture to guess he might have been a local politician or well known figure in the community.

Listed amongst the beautiful swimsuit clad ladies here, we have beauty queens from (my town of) Penticton, Kamloops, and what looks like it probably says Trail, as well as a few others whose sashes we're unable to see.
